Show hotseat instead of stashed taskbar handle after entering stage split from fullscreen app via keyboard shortcut
Besides finishing the recents animation from fullscreen app, we also need to update the taskbar state
Fixes: 323561157
Test: Go to a fullscreen app, trigger the split shortcut, make sure the hotseat icons are visible on the home screen
